Using press releases for SEO (Search Engine Optimization) can significantly enhance your online visibility and drive traffic to your website. Here’s a step-by-step guide on how to effectively use press releases for SEO: Keyword Research: Start by identifying relevant keywords that align with your brand, products, or services. Use tools like Google Keyword Planner or SEMrush to find keywords with high search volume and low competition. Incorporate these keywords naturally into your press release, particularly in the headline, subheadings, and first paragraph.
 Crafting a Compelling Headline: Your headline should be engaging and include the primary keyword. An attention-grabbing headline not only attracts readers but also signals to search engines what your content is about.
 Optimize the Content: Ensure your press release is informative and valuable. Integrate keywords throughout the text but avoid keyword stuffing. Use them in a way that reads naturally. Additionally, include links to your website or specific landing pages to drive traffic and improve your site's authority.
 Multimedia Elements: Adding images, videos, or infographics can make your press release more appealing and shareable. Multimedia elements often rank well in search results, providing additional SEO benefits.
 Distribution: Use reputable press release distribution services like PR Newswire, Business Wire, or PRWeb. These platforms have high domain authority and can help your press release get picked up by other media outlets, increasing your reach and backlink opportunities.
 Monitor and Measure: After distribution, track the performance of your press release. Use tools like Google Analytics and Google Search Console to monitor traffic, engagement, and backlinks generated from the press release. Analyzing these metrics will help you understand its impact on your SEO efforts and refine future strategies.
